Additionally, how much are honey crisp apples? Most other apples—the Galas, Romes, Granny Smiths and Red Deliciouses—cost just over $1 per pound. But the price of Honeycrisps have skyrocketed to about $4.50 per pound, according to Esquire's Elizabeth Gunnison Dunn.
Secondly, are Honeycrisp apples good for you?
The health benefits from eating apples are numerous. One medium Honeycrisp apple has 5 grams of fiber and only 80 calories. The pectin in apples may also help lower cholesterol. The flesh and peel are packed with disease-fighting antioxidants and phytochemicals that may protect against breast and lung cancer.
What Apple is comparable to Honeycrisp?
SweeTango A close relative of the Honeycrisp, this variety was created in Minnesota, and as their name implies, their flavor profile balances notes of sweetness and tanginess. An apple this crisp and delicious is best for snacking, as some of its delicate flavor could get lost when baked or cooked.

How do you know when a Honeycrisp apple is ripe?
Each Honeycrisp apple has an undertone, a slight blush of green in its pink-red skin. The best Honeycrisps, say Luby, are the ones whose green blush exhibits a slight yellowness. If there's too much yellow, that means the apple is far too ripe.Why are apples so big?
